Unilorin Chief Imam Tasks Muslims, Christians on Objectivity

Date: 2012-08-19

Muslim and Christian faithful have been called upon to embrace objectivity in their preaching and avoid inciting followers to violence.

The Chief Imam of University of Ilorin, Professor Abdulganiyu Oladosu, said this at the Second Radio Nigeria Harmony FM Ramadan Lecture (Tafsir) at Idofian, Kwara State.

In a paper, titled, 'Achieving Peace and Unity Through Religion: The Islamic Approach',

Oladosu enjoined pastors and imams to incorporate Muslim-Christian materials into their addresses, lectures and sermons as way of achieving peaceful co-existence.

He also suggested that a National Joint Committee be set up to address ethno-religious conflicts and other matters of mutual interests at all levels of government. This should be supervised by the Nigeria Inter-Religious Council (NIREC) and funded by the federal government.

Oladosu, who decried the level of insecurity in the country, particularly the burning of places of worship, said that under no circumstance should a Muslim or Christian be killed in the name of religion.

Chairman of the occasion and Kwara State Commissioner for Energy, Alhaji Tajudeen Sulu-Oloje, who commended Radio Nigeria Harmony FM for the lecture, said the state government remains resolute at ensuring peace and harmony.

Also speaking, Coordinator of Muslim Media Watch Group, Alhaji Abdullahi Ibrahim, said there is need for harmonious relationship between Christians and Muslims.

Earlier in an address, General Manager of Radio Nigeria Harmony FM Idofian, Alhaji AbdulMualiy Olarewaju Adegboyega, said the country would witness rapid economic growth and development when there is relative peace among adherents of Islam and Christianity.

The Ramadan lecture was attended by Islamic scholars and traditional rulers from across the state including the Oludofian of Idofian, Oba Zubair Agboola Oyesoro (II).
